## Support

If compaction on Quillbus stalls (you'll see segment counts climbing in the dashboard), don't panic — it usually self-heals after the next checkpoint. If it doesn't within 30 minutes, restart the compactor pod and check the tombstone ratio. Anything weirder than that, like corrupted offsets or duplicate keys surviving compaction, escalate to the Quillbus core team. They're quick to respond during business hours.

escalation mailbox, bafog-fafog: ulador@paliqlabs.internal

Minutes — Management Meeting, Expansion into the Sellaran Market

Attendees: regional heads plus the commercial team. Quick recap: the Sellaran launch is on for next quarter, pending warehouse signoff. Priya walked through the pricing ladder; sales leads should hold margins and resist early discounting. Marketing collateral lands in two weeks. Hiring for the local field team starts immediately. Next check-in is in a fortnight. For the sales leads only, the note below stays confidential.

confidential, yaweg-bafog: The western region missed its Druael quota by 42.1 percent last quarter. Wenokix Group plans to raise the Alddor list price by 36.3 percent in June. The finance team signed off on a budget of $272.6 million for Project Rusax. The renewal with Istiusix Systems closes at $334.2 million a year, 62.9 percent below the last contract.

# Runbook: Hunting leaked file descriptors in Quillgate

When the `fd_open` gauge climbs steadily between deploys, suspect a leak rather than load. First confirm on a single pod: exec in and count entries under `/proc/1/fd`, noting how many are sockets in CLOSE_WAIT versus regular files. Capture two snapshots ten minutes apart before restarting anything — we need the delta for the postmortem. Reproduce locally with the Marbury load harness, which requires the service running with the following configuration values.

settings of yagep-bajog:
[istdor]
port = 4000
region = south-2
host = istdor.qorvelcorp.internal
timeout_ms = 5000
retries = 5